Designed for shooting amateur films on Super-8 film. See-through viewfinder with translucent mirror.
Sighting and focusing on a focusing screen with a microraster. Filming frequency 9, 12, 18, 24, 32 frames per second and single frame. Spring drive LPM path with manual winding. The camera is loaded with a Super 8 cassette, both non-separable disposable and collapsible rechargeable type KS-8. The film counter resets when you change the cassette.
Automatic exposure setting with light metering - TTL. Range of change of focal length: from 9 to 23 mm. Aperture control - automatic and manual.
Film speed: ASA-40 and ASA-25. Frame-by-frame shooting with a cable release screwed into the shutter release button. Only 16092 pieces were produced.
